Oracle DBA的日常职责与关键操作
69 浏览量
更新于2024-06-29
收藏 50KB PPT 举报
"该资源为一个关于Oracle DBA(数据库管理员)职责的PPT文档,由eygle在2005-2008年间创作。文档主要讲述了DBA的重要职责,强调了备份的重要性,规范制定与遵守,以及日常监控和维护工作。"
Oracle DBA(数据库管理员)在数据库管理中扮演着至关重要的角色,他们的主要职责可以概括如下:
1. **备份与恢复策略**:DBA必须确保有有效的备份系统,因为系统崩溃是不可避免的。有效的备份是防止数据丢失的关键,DBA需要定期验证备份的完整性和可恢复性。
2. **谨慎操作**:DBA执行任何操作前都需要深思熟虑,避免不必要的风险。在UNIX环境下,误用`rm`命令可能导致不可逆的数据丢失,因此DBA需格外小心。
3. **规范制定与执行**:良好的规范有助于减少故障的发生。DBA应制定一套标准操作程序(SOP),包括数据库管理、备份策略、性能优化等方面,并确保团队遵循这些规范。
4. **定期监控**:DBA需要定期检查Oracle数据库的运行状态、日志文件、备份情况、磁盘空间使用情况及系统资源利用率,及时发现并解决问题。
- 每天的工作包括检查所有实例的状态、文件系统的空间使用、日志文件和错误记录,以及备份的有效性。
5. **周期性审查**:每周,DBA应对数据库对象的空间扩展、数据增长进行监控,进行健康检查,检查对象状态。每月,应进行表和索引的分析,评估表空间碎片,进行性能调整,并规划下一步的空间管理。
6. **性能调优**:DBA需要通过分析表和索引来识别性能瓶颈,进行必要的调整,以优化数据库性能。
7. **错误处理与解决**:DBA需密切关注alert和trace文件,记录并解决出现的错误,确保数据库的稳定运行。
8. **安全与合规**:DBA还需关注数据库的安全性,确保数据的机密性、完整性和可用性,遵守相关的法规和标准。
通过这些职责,Oracle DBA能够确保数据库的高效、可靠运行,预防和解决可能出现的问题,保证业务的连续性和数据的安全性。这份PPT文档提供了DBA日常工作的具体步骤和注意事项,对于理解Oracle DBA的角色和任务具有很高的参考价值。
点击了解资源详情
点击了解资源详情
点击了解资源详情
2023-09-05 上传
2021-09-21 上传
2022-11-22 上传
2021-11-25 上传
2010-03-03 上传
2022-11-22 上传
Mmnnnbb123
- 粉丝: 749
- 资源: 8万+
最新资源
- MATLAB新功能:Multi-frame ViewRGB制作彩色图阴影
- XKCD Substitutions 3-crx插件:创新的网页文字替换工具
- Python实现8位等离子效果开源项目plasma.py解读
- 维护商店移动应用:基于PhoneGap的移动API应用
- Laravel-Admin的Redis Manager扩展使用教程
- Jekyll代理主题使用指南及文件结构解析
- cPanel中PHP多版本插件的安装与配置指南
- 深入探讨React和Typescript在Alias kopio游戏中的应用
- node.js OSC服务器实现:Gibber消息转换技术解析
- 体验最新升级版的mdbootstrap pro 6.1.0组件库
- 超市盘点过机系统实现与delphi应用
- Boogle: 探索 Python 编程的 Boggle 仿制品
- C++实现的Physics2D简易2D物理模拟
- 傅里叶级数在分数阶微分积分计算中的应用与实现
- Windows Phone与PhoneGap应用隔离存储文件访问方法
- iso8601-interval-recurrence:掌握ISO8601日期范围与重复间隔检查